From the fiery Poo in Kabhi Khushi Kabhie Gham to the quietly fierce Kalindi in Veere Di Wedding, Kareena Kapoor Khan has never just played characters—she’s embodied eras. A generational talent with unapologetic flair, Bebo isn’t just a Bollywood star, she’s a cultural force.
Whether she was blazing a trail with Jab We Met’s Geet—teaching millions the power of self-love—or owning her choices in motherhood, marriage, and movies, Kareena has constantly challenged the boxes women are put in. She’s balanced glamour with grit, superstardom with substance.
Off-screen, she’s redefined what it means to be a working mother, spoken openly about body image and self-worth, and stood her ground in a deeply patriarchal industry. Kareena’s journey isn’t just about silver screen success—it’s about resilience, reinvention, and ruling with grace.
From her iconic dialogues to her fearless voice, Kareena Kapoor isn’t just a woman icon. She’s the woman icon—flawed, fabulous, and forever setting her own rules.
